Intercollegiate Athletics

Sewanee fields 24 intercollegiate varsity teams, is a member of the NCAA Division III, and competes in the 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µern Athletic Association (SAA). Over 30 percent of the student body competes at the varsity level.

Club Sports

Sewanee's club sports scene is vibrant and diverse. Our men's and women's rugby, crew, squash, equestrian eventing teams are all competitive nationally. The Tiger Tennis Club plays in tournaments around the 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µ. And did we mention fencing? Yep, Sewanee has a club fencing team, too. En garde! Don't see the sport you're looking for? If you are willing, you can start your own club team.

Intramurals

With more than 800 participants each year, Sewanee intramurals give the whole campus community a chance to mix it up. Basketball, flag football, wiffleball, dodgeball, and indoor soccer are among the most popular options. Grab your gear, there's a spot for you.

Facilities

The Wellness Commons, located at the heart of campus, opened in 2020 and brings the Wellness Center, FitWell, and Sewanee Outing Program all together under one roof. The Fowler Center includes competition, training, and recreational venues for Sewanee's varsity athletes as well as the campus community. The on-campus golf course, the Course at Sewanee, was recently redesigned by renowned course architect Gil Hanse.
